CALL FOR APPLICATIONS FOR LEGISLATIVE BLACK

CAUCUS 2012 SUMMER YOUTH LEADERSHIP PROGRAM

  

Sacramento - The California Legislative Black Caucus has issued a call for applications for its annual African American Leaders for Tomorrow Program (AALTP).

 

The weeklong residential summer program will be held at California State University, Sacramento (CSUS), from July 2128, 2012.

 

Fifty (50) students will be selected for participation in the program to receive leadership training and attend workshops on topics including financial literacy, effective leadership, college preparation and the importance of community advocacy.

 

Students will stay on the CSUS campus in school dormitories. Housing, meals, program materials and transportation during the conference will be provided at no cost to the participants. Transportation will also be provided to Sacramento for students selected for the Los Angeles area.

 

REQUIREMENTS

      Students currently in good academic standing as of January 1, 2012, and eligible to graduate in 2013 or 2014 with a 2.5 or higher GPA.

      Demonstration of leadership potential (i.e. involvement in student government, community leadership or similar activities).

      Current high school transcript.

      Two letters of recommendation. One letter must be from a school official and one from a community member who is not related to you.

      Essay Requirements (2 required).

 

TIMELINE

1.MARCH 28, 2012 - Applications will be available.

2.June 18, 2012 - Application deadline.

3.July 2, 2012 - Students will be notified.

4.July 2128, 2012 AALTP Summer Program
